Chest, Vol 79, 116-118, Copyright © 1981 by American College of Chest Physicians
ARTICLES |
CB Loeppky, MA Alpert, PC Hamel, RH Martin and SB Saab
A 33-year-old man with no predisposing factors had a DeBakey type 1 aortic dissection requiring surgical intervention. Microscopic examination showed combined-type cystic medial necrosis. This is the first report of extensive aortic dissection associated with combined- type cystic medial necrosis in a person younger than 40 years with no predisposing factors.
